French and Teacher Jobs in Canada

keywords
locations Please select the country where you want to search for a job.
Please select the country where you want to search for a job.
Please enter keywords to search relevant jobs
  • City filter icon
  • Job Type filter icon
  • Posting Date filter icon
Clear All

697 Jobs Found | Sort By : Relevance | Posted Date

Not-Found

Less results matching your search!

Try removing some of the filters to get more results

Reset Filters
Not-Found

No results matching your search!

Try removing some of the filters to get more results

Reset Filters

Temporary Music & Intervention Teacher

Peace River School Division

profile Peace River - Canada

The Peace River School Division is seeking applications for a Full-Time (1.00 f.t.e.)Temporary ElementaryTeacher at École Springfield Elementary School. This position will commence on November 19 2025 and continue until December 19 2025 with the possibility of an extension. The initial assignment wi...

30+ days ago
Full Time

Full Time Grade 8 Teacher

Wild Rose School Division

profile Rocky Mountain House - Canada

Wild Rose School Division requires A FULL TIME GRADE 8 TEACHER For Pioneer Middle School in Rocky Mountain House Alberta Applications are invited for a Full Time Grade 8 Math and Science Teacher. Pioneer Middle School is seeking a temporary Grade 8 Math & Science teacher to cover a leave at l...

30+ days ago
Full Time

Tenure Track In Teacher Education And Curriculum &...

St. Francis Xavier University

profile Antigonish - Canada

Position DescriptionThe Faculty of Educations Department of Teacher Education and Department of Curriculum and Leadership at St. Francis Xavier University (StFX) invite applications for a probationary-track appointment at the rank of Assistant Professor to begin July 1 2026. This position is subject...

30+ days ago
Full Time

Grade 4 And Grade 7 Teacher At Spruce Ridge School

South East Cornerstone Public School Division #209

profile Estevan - Canada

Spruce Ridge School located in the community of Estevan Saskatchewan requires the service of a dedicated classroom teacher. Position Details: 1.0 FTE Temporary Assignment: Grade 4Grade 7 Term: Start date: January 5 2026 End date: March 25 2026 Duties: As outlined in the Education Act 19...

30+ days ago
Full Time

#219.1 Temporary, Part-time (.200 Fte) Grade 6 Cla...

Coast Mountains

profile Terrace - Canada

Click Here to Learn More About Us! -Recruitment Video About our Community -Northwest British Columbia Visit Our Website -Coast Mountains School District 82 Available Job Opportunities Coast Mountains School District 82 has a rich tapestry of cultures backgrounds learning styles and needs. Located...

30+ days ago
Part-Time

T2526-445 0.40 Fte Temporary French Immersion Inte...

Comox Valley

profile Comox - Canada

School District 71 is aninclusive learning community that embraces diversity fosters relationships and empowers all learners to have a positive impact on the world. Our mission is to work with our educational partners to inspire engaged compassionate resilient lifelong learners and cultivate a coll...

30+ days ago
Contract

Associate Technical Fellow Aiml

Microchip

profile Toronto - Canada

Are you looking for a unique opportunity to be a part of something great Want to join a 17000-member team that works on the technology that powers the world around us Looking for an atmosphere of trust empowerment respect diversity and communication How about an opportunity to own a piece of a multi...

30+ days ago
Full Time

Supply Teacher- Snpss

Six Nations Polytechnic

profile Brantford - Canada

Six Nations Polytechnic (SNP) is a unique Indigenous Institute recognized by community government and institutions of higher learning as a Centre of Excellence for Indigenous Knowledge. SNP offers secondary postsecondary trades education and training. SNP has formal partnerships with nine publicly f...

30+ days ago
Contract

Temporary Kindergarten Teacher

Golden Hills School Division

profile Drumheller - Canada

The Golden Hills School Division invites applicationsfor a Part - time ( 0.4 FTE) temporary teacher at Greentree Elementary School in Drumheller AB from Wednesday November 12 th to Friday December 12 th 2025 . The teaching assignment is for kindergarten. Greentree School is a Kindergarten to...

30+ days ago
Part-Time

Secondary French Immersion Teacher

New Westminster

profile New Westminster - Canada

New Westminster Schools Career Opportunity New Westminster Schools is seeking qualified French Immersion Teachers for the following position:Temporary Full-time French Immersion Secondary Teacher(Science PE)About New Westminster Schools Serving the community of New Westminster the New Westminster S...

30+ days ago
Full Time

#33-202526 Kindergartenprimary Teacher

School District #53

profile Oliver - Canada

DATE: November 5 2025SCHOOL: Tuc-el-Nuit Elementary School POSTING: #33 - 2025/26 POSITION: Kindergarten/PrimaryTeacher APPOINTMENT: 1.0FTE Temporary DURATION: January 1 to June 30 2026 or earlier return of incumbentper Article C.24.5 Qualifications Require...

30+ days ago
Full Time

Interim Green Zone Teacher

Golden Hills School Division

profile Drumheller - Canada

The Golden Hills School Division invites applicationsfor a 0.5 FTE Interim teacher at Greentree Elementary School in Drumheller AB for the 2025/2026 school year. The teaching assignment is for the Green Zone Classroom. Green Zone is a class of students with a range of learning needs. Green...

30+ days ago
Part-Time

#217.1 Temporary, Part-time (.300 Fe) Resource Tea...

Coast Mountains

profile Terrace - Canada

Click Here to Learn More About Us! -Recruitment Video About our Community -Northwest British Columbia Visit Our Website -Coast Mountains School District 82 Available Job Opportunities Coast Mountains School District 82 has a rich tapestry of cultures backgrounds learning styles and needs. Located...

30+ days ago
Part-Time

#214.1 Temporary, Part-time (.600 Fte) Grade 56 Cl...

Coast Mountains

profile Terrace - Canada

Click Here to Learn More About Us! -Recruitment Video About our Community -Northwest British Columbia Visit Our Website -Coast Mountains School District 82 Available Job Opportunities Coast Mountains School District 82 has a rich tapestry of cultures backgrounds learning styles and needs. Located...

30+ days ago
Part-Time

Teacher Grade 4

Yukon Education

profile Dawson City - Canada

Living In Yukon Thriving in Life Our goal is to support all learners in developing the essential skills knowledge and personal qualities that they need to thrive in life. Are you passionate about shaping the future of education in the Yukon The Department of Education is dedicated to providing high-...

30+ days ago
Full Time

Substitute Teacher Bonnyville, Alberta

Lakeland Catholic Schools

profile Bonnyville - Canada

Join Our Team at Lakeland Catholic School Division! Substitute Teachers Bonnyville Area Start Date: ImmediatelyLocations: École Notre Dame Elementary School Dr. Bernard Brosseau Middle School and École Notre Dame High SchoolAt Lakeland Catholic we are committed to nurturing the whole childm...

30+ days ago
Temp

High School Teacher Librarian

King David High School

profile Vancouver - Canada

High School Teacher Librarian Full-time (1.0 FTE) - Maternity Leave positionStarting Date: Monday January 5 2026 Who we are: King David High School is a top-rated independent school in central Vancouver with memberships in ISABC and CAIS. Our staff come from all walks of life and backgrounds we va...

30+ days ago
Full Time

Learning Assistance Teacher & Literacy Interventio...

Yukon Education

profile Dawson City - Canada

Living In Yukon Thriving in Life Our goal is to support all learners in developing the essential skills knowledge and personal qualities that they need to thrive in life. Are you passionate about shaping the future of education in the Yukon The Department of Education is dedicated to providing high-...

30+ days ago
Full Time

Substitute Teacher Lac La Biche, Alberta

Lakeland Catholic Schools

profile Lac La Biche - Canada

Join Our Team at Lakeland Catholic School Division! Substitute Teachers Lac La Biche Area Start Date: ImmediatelyLocations: Light of Christ Catholic SchoolAt Lakeland Catholic we are dedicated to providing high-quality education and positive learning experiences for students in every grade....

30+ days ago
Temp

Teacher Teaching On Call Princeton Schools

School District #58

profile Merritt - Canada

TEACHER TEACHING ON CALL PRINCETON SCHOOLS Job Code No.Nicola-Similkameen School District serves the two communities of Merritt and Princeton as well as six First Nations Bands the Métis and the Conayt Friendship Society. The mountains lakes and valleys within the district make it a natural se...

30+ days ago
Temp